Title: Dark Side of the Cosmic Star Formation and Black Hole Mass Accretion History

Speaker: Prof. Min S. Yun (UMass, Amherst)

Date&Time: 2023-06-20, 16:00 PM

Location: 과학관 638호 (Science Hall, 638)

Language: English

----------------------------------------------------------------------------


Abstract:

One of the exciting new science results from the early JWST data is the ubiquitous presence of heavily obscured ("HST-dark") galaxies in the NIRCAM surveys. Follow-up studies have shown that many are dusty star forming galaxies at z=2 to 6 (and in some cases z>10). Some of these galaxies were already known from deep radio, mm/submm, and IR surveys, confirming their dusty nature. In this talk, I will discuss the contribution by these heavily obscured galaxies to the cosmic star formation history and (more speculatively) black hole mass accretion history using the ultra-deep 1000 hr long exposure VLA observation of the COSMOS field and its rich archival multi-wavelength database.
